This CD came out awesome! The solos, songs and drumming came out excellent. Our 3 different styles work well together and make the CD very interesting. Rock, metal, jazz, pop, it's all in there.

I wrote and played 3 songs ( Lydian Field, Transcendence, General Relativity Jam ) and Milan and Ale added a solo to each song. Lale also plays on one. I also play a solo on Milan's 3 songs and Ale's 3 songs. Our different writing styles also makes things interesting . They wrote some really cool tunes! I've been listening to the CD over and over for 2 days now.

Here is the original press release:

"Liquid Note Records are proud to announce another musical collaboration.
Towards the end of 2003 the label plans to release an MVP-style feast of guitar
and keyboard playing featuring some of the best players in the business.
The three guitarists involved will be: American Joel Rivard (http://www.joelrivard.com/),Austrian Milan Polak
(
http://www.milanpolak.com/) and Italian Alessandro Benvenuti
(
http://www.alessandrobenvenuti.com/). All 3 have a wealth
of experience under their belt, having performed live many times and
having contributed to several musical projects utilising lots of
different styles. The project will focus on hard-edged fusion, with each
player writing 3 songs which the others will solo over. The project will
also feature keyboard maestro, Lale Larson (
http://www.lalelarson.com/)
(last heard on The Alchemists). Drummers and bassists to be announced.
This promises to be a feast of fantastic musicianship and unrestrained
virtuoso playing. "
